Mojang Studios Note
14 Sep 22 - Thank you for your patience while we continue to work on addressing the issue raised here. While we don't have an ETA for a fix at this point, please be assured we are actively looking into a solution and apologize for any inconvenience caused.
For those still affected, please try clearing the cache in the latest version, to see if that helps.
Navigate to Minecraft > Settings > Storage
Select and delete any world templates and cached items that you don't need
Exit Minecraft and restart your device
For Nintendo Switch specifically, you can also:
Navigate to Minecraft > Settings > Storage
Press the Clear Marketplace Cache button at the top
Exit Minecraft and restart your device

I found important details about this issue:
1. The issue occurs in 1.16.210 when AUTO UPDATE starts on available updates.
2. On an unaffected device, if you turn off Wi-Fi, go into Minecraft settings and turn OFF auto update; you can then turn on Wi-Fi and then manually update without issue.
3. If you then turn back on auto update and let it run, it will screw up the rest of the packs that need updating.
4. Deleting pre-existing/old-versions of the "stuck" packs in Settings/Storage will reset the download, but if Auto Update is enabled, Auto Update will "stuck" the downloads again. Because the downloads never start, the newly attempted packs will never show again in settings/storage - you can only delete the pre-existing packs once. (i'd like to test if deleting the packs with auto update disabled will permit a manual update, but I've run out of devices with purchases.)

I also had this problem. For me the workaround was:
Turn off auto update.
Quit application.
Delete everything in ...\AppData\Local\Packages\Microsoft.MinecraftUWP_8wekyb3d8bbwe\LocalCache\minecraftpe
Restart application
Go to market and the download button is back!

Hi, I've just fixed this 'stuck at downloading' issue, and it's less drastic than others' solutions.
Close the game.
(Scroll this window to see the whole folder if reading this post on a phone)
Delete the .Completed files from this folder
C:\Users\<userID>\AppData\Local\Packages\Microsoft.MinecraftUWP_8wekyb3d8bbwe\LocalCache\minecraftpe\DownloadTemp
Then start the game.
Done.

Amazon Kindle Fire for kids. The following solution worked.
I had less than 1GB free total space. That was not enough for the system and therefore contributing to the problem. I needed to add an SD card (note: Kindle requires a certain speed and recommended XC I), format it, and move data or apps onto it (I moved data) to free up space.
Upgrade to the latest version of Minecraft (currently 1.19.51). Do this from the parent account as kids account doesn't have permissions. Go to Appstore, search for Minecraft. Click on the Minecraft icon and not the "open" button. Then upgrade.
Log back into the kids account, launch Minecraft, go into Settings -> Storage -> Clear Marketplace Cache.
Important! Restart device.
Log back into the kids account, launch Minecraft, go into Marketplace and find item(s) you were trying to download. They should be downloadable now.

KINDLE FIRE SOLVED: 1.19.70
If you have a child’s profile (ir Amazon Kids Plus), the problem is due to Amazon’s Content Filtering features.
So there are two parts to the solution: The Amazon filter settings, and the Minecraft settings.
Amazon Settings:
Log in to the parent / device admin account on the Kindle Fire and follow these steps:
Open the Settings App
Parental Controls
Household Profiles
Manage <childnane>’s Profile
In the “Web Settings” subsection, select “Modify Web Browser.”
ENABLE Filtered Websites and Videos
Restart the tablet
Now for the Minecraft side of the solution.
Log in as the child.
Go to Settings / Storage
Select “Clear Marketplace Cache.”. THIS WILL TAKE A LONG TIME. Be patient.
RESTART THE TABLET AGAIN

Another way of fixing the issue (Windows)
This method may help if the other steps haven't helped and it keeps your already downloaded packs
1. Use Windows Key + R or search the app "Run" and open the program
2. Type/copy and paste this into the box provided: %LocalAppData%\Packages\Microsoft.MinecraftUWP_8wekyb3d8bbwe\LocalCache\minecraftpe\DownloadTemp
3. Press "OK"
4. Delete "download_state.json
" (or you can just delete everything, it doesn't seem to matter)
5. Reopen Minecraft and you should see that the download progress bars are gone, and you should now be able to properly download all packs!

Partial Cause
I found a partial cause of this problem (more specifically, why it keeps showing as "Downloading")
The processState "downloadPending" is stuck in the download_state.json
until the cancel button is pressed, but the cancel button does not go back to the content screen, only the X button does. With the X button, the processState is kept along with the rest of the pack info in that same file when it should be removed as it causes it to keep showing that it is "downloading". I recorded a side-by-side video of the game and the file being updated.
